Russia's war chest is being hammered by the doublewhammy of a slump in oil shipments and a continuing decline in prices, sending the value of crude exports to the lowest since January 2023.

Four-week average crude flows fell in the period to December 14, driven by the biggest week-on-week slump in flows since the 2022 invasion of Ukraine. Offloading cargoes is proving even more of a challenge, with crude at sea jumping 40% since the end of August and at least 20 cargoes loaded at the country's western ports in September and October still undelivered.

Numerous tankers have disappeared from tracking systems in the Riau archipelago, northeast of Singapore, a favoured location for transferring sanctioned Iranian barrels between vessels that's growing in popularity among carriers of Moscow's crude. Tracks suggest that at least six Russian cargo switches have taken place there since November, with another six fully-laden tankers disappearing in the area so far this month.
